The Benefits of the Enterprise Performance Index

Raw KPIs are normalized into index values and evaluated against company goals or industry standards. This allows project-based companies to see how the overall business, departments, and teams are performing in certain key operational and financial areas.  High-level executives can see operational and financial items such as scheduling delays or margin erosion that need improving so they can spend time focusing on those areas. Essentially, the EPI provides a way to see how the business is doing and drill down into specific areas that need further attention, providing a roadmap for improvement.

The EPI provides:

  • Color codes to make it easy to identify performance variances
  • Trend indicators to illustrate improving or deteriorating indexes by analyzing your performance over time
  • Visibility into specific portfolio and portfolio group levels
